A nation to pray for today— Venezuela: Spiritual forces battle in Venezuela. Both rich and poor visit witch doctors in the thousands of spiritist and occult shops. Fewer people go to church in Venezuela than in any other Latin American nation. Millions of former Catholics chose evangelical faith or no religion at all. Pray for the Holy Spirit to bind all the powers that blind Venezuelans to Truth, and to reveal Christ to all. ~Operation World
